Beijing airport is an international airport located in China. Beijing Capital International Airport Company limited operated the airport as they own it. The IAKA code for Beijing international airport is based on city name Peking and the code is PEK. Beijing airport is considered as world’s busiest airport because of the passenger traffic. In 2009, Beijing airport is known as the world’s 3rd busiest airport as it was capable of handling 65,329,851 passengers. Regarding aircraft movement it is ranked as 10th in the world.
The Beijing airport is a main hub for many airlines such as Air china, Hainan and china southern airlines. Initially when Beijing airport was opened (opened on March 2nd, 1958), for the use of charter and VIP flights it has one small terminal. On September 20th, 2004 the new terminal which was opened on November 1st, named as terminal 2. Few airlines used terminal 1 for domestic and international flights while all other airlines used terminal 2 for international and domestic flights. In order to handle the traffic congestion, a new run way was opened on October 29th, 2007. In February 2008, the completion of terminal 3 ended. It was largest expansion which was funded by 500 million Euro loan. The agreement for loan from EIB (European investment bank) was signed in September 2005.
